Output 25ef3c871a162e7198d8ee3c8cfcad7ce210b89931036fca17c5faac2a4e3e2f:1

value
596834649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95dd494ea5118445a76599cab352700d3c13aeba OP_EQUAL
address
3FMRhNXtHVJZajEtpmMMXGRfKeNhRawL94
transaction
25ef3c871a162e7198d8ee3c8cfcad7ce210b89931036fca17c5faac2a4e3e2f
confirmations
288434
spent
true